Comprehending Bay Windows
Before diving into how to find the best installer, it's essential to grasp what bay windows are and their benefits. A bay window integrates three or more window panels that extend beyond the exterior wall of a structure, forming a little alcove. They can be developed in numerous designs, including standard Victorian, modern, and even custom styles.
Advantages of Bay WindowsNatural Light: Bay windows enable more sunshine to enter your home, creating a brilliant and welcoming atmosphere.Increased Space: The extension into the space offers additional space for furnishings or design.Visual Appeal: They add a special architectural aspect to your home, enhancing curb appeal.Improved Ventilation: Depending on the design, bay windows can be opened to enable much better airflow.Steps to Find Quality Bay Window Installers1. Costs of Bay Window Installation
The cost of installing a bay window can differ significantly depending on different aspects, consisting of the size, product, installation complexity, and geographical area. Below is a general cost breakdown:
Cost FactorAverage CostWindow Units (3-panel)₤ 1,000 - ₤ 2,500Installation Labor₤ 300 - ₤ 1,200Extra Materials (frames, drywall)₤ 200 - ₤ 1,000Total Estimated Cost₤ 1,500 - ₤ 4,700
Keep in mind: Costs can substantially vary based upon personalizations and local market conditions.
FAQs About Bay Window InstallationQ1: How long does it require to install a bay window?
Typically, a bay window installation can take anywhere from a couple of hours to a couple of days, depending on the intricacy of the project and the installer's schedule.
Q2: What materials are best for bay windows?
Common products for bay windows consist of vinyl, wood, fiberglass, and aluminum. Each material features distinct benefits and downsides relating to insulation, maintenance, and cost.
Q3: Are permits needed for bay window installation?
Many local municipalities require permits for structural modifications, including adding brand-new bay windows. It's vital to inspect local policies and consult your installer about obtaining the required licenses.
Q4: How do I keep my bay windows?
Routine cleaning and evaluation are important. Clean the glass with a mild solution, and look for any signs of wear or damage around the framing to guarantee long-lasting efficiency.
Q5: Can I change only part of my bay window?
Yes. If the bay window structure is sound, it is often possible to replace just the window panels. Consult your installer for specific suggestions based upon your present windows.
